The Si8941/46/47 are galvanically isolated delta-sigma modulators which output a digital signal proportional to the voltage level at the input. The low-voltage differential input is ideal for measuring voltage across a current shunt resistor or for any place where a sensor must be isolated from the .
• Low voltage differential input - ±62.5 mV and ±250 mV options
• Modulator clock options - External clock up to 25 MHz (Si8941) - 10 MHz internal clock (Si8946) - 20 MHz internal clock (Si8947)
• Typical input offset: ±50 µV
• Typical gain error: ±0.05%
• Excellent drift specifications
- ±0.5 µV/°C typical offset drift - ±4 ppm/°C typical gain drift
• Typical 14-bit (ENOB) precision
• High common-mode transient immunity: 75 kV/µs
• Typical SNR: 90 dB
• Typical THD:
–97 dB
